Dr. Rebecca McLaughlin is a learned, feisty academic who's not afraid to confront the challenge that this two thousand year old faith has run its course.
Claims of institutionalised homophobia, that religion is bad for us, and scare tactics surrounding the teaching of Hell - they all surface in this episode.
Faced with the most challenging questions of the day, Dr. McLaughlin offers a spirited defence of Christianity that John Dickson thinks amounts to the best answer to troubling questions since Tim Keller's Reasons For God.
